Abstract
Background:
Primary care physicians (PCPs) in rural township health centers are the most easily accessible doctors to the residents in rural China, which covers 35% of the population. High prevalence of depression was reported among rural left-behind elderly and children as many workers had migrated to urban cities.
Aim:
This study explored mental health care provision by PCPs in rural China and the association with their training background.
Methods:
Rural township health centers in both developed and less developed counties of Zhejiang Province, China were chosen as the study sites. A total of 697 PCPs completed questionnaires between December 2019 and January 2020, and the number of valid questionnaires was 673, with a valid response rate of 79.3%.
Results:
The rural PCPs reported a median range of seeing 1 to 5 mental health patients per week. Over two-thirds (68.2%) of the respondents had never received any training on treating common mental health disorders (depression and anxiety) while 20.3% received at most 2 days of training; 6.4% received 3 to 20 days of training; and 5.1% received over 20 days of training. PCPs with mental health training were significantly associated with better mental health care in terms of confidence and practice characteristics (e.g. having patients who brought up mental health issues, providing follow-up), while years of practice made a difference in practice but not confidence.
Conclusions:
Training is the key determinant of the practice of mental health care by the PCPs in rural China. Our findings have implications for national policy to target two-thirds of rural PCPs who received no mental health training.
Introduction
The Chinese government has promulgated its health care reform initiative – Health China 2030 (Tan et al., 2017) to promote management for common mental disorders including depression and anxiety. A nationwide epidemiological survey conducted across 31 provinces found that the weighted lifetime prevalence of mood disorders and anxiety disorders identified from standard screening tools were 7.4% and 7.6% respectively (Huang et al., 2019). Another study analyzing data from a national health and wellness survey found that only 8.0% of patients with depression were properly diagnosed in clinical settings, and half of these diagnosed individuals were treated with anti-depressants (Gupta et al., 2016). A study in four provinces of China found that while the help-seeking rate for common mental disorders was low, a higher percentage of patients had sought help from primary care physicians (PCPs) than psychiatrists (Phillips et al., 2009). More detailed information about the PCPs’ involvement in diagnosing, managing and referring mental health patients is needed. Such information is especially lacking in the rural areas, which cover over 35% of the population in China (National Bureau of Statistics of China, 2021).
The prevalence of depressive symptoms in Liaoning Province (a less developed province) among middle-aged people was 5.9% (Zhou et al., 2014). Mental health of children and elderly in rural areas is a bigger concern (Cheng & Sun, 2015; He et al., 2016). With the rapid economic development in the past few decades, the traditional family structure in rural China has experienced dramatic changes. A report revealed that 159 million rural residents have migrated to major cities in 2011, and only 33 million brought their families with them since many were unable to afford the high living costs in urban areas (National Bureau of Statistics of the People’s Republic of China, 2012). Their children and parents are thus left in the rural hometowns. Being left behind with less family contact and support may increase their vulnerability to mental health problems (Cheng & Sun, 2015; He et al., 2012). A systematic review revealed that the prevalence of depression of left-behind children in China ranged from 12.1% to 51.4% and the prevalence of anxiety ranged from 13.2% to 57.6% (Cheng & Sun, 2015). The prevalence of depressive symptoms in rural left-behind elderly was found to be 36.9% (He et al., 2016), which was much higher than that of the 23.6% among the general Chinese population (Li et al., 2014).
Despite the high prevalence of depression, utilization of mental health services is relatively low among patients living in rural areas (Wei et al., 2011). Mental health services are available in the psychiatric departments of the hospitals in urban areas, however, they are usually not accessible by the rural population due to financial hardships, stigma, and distance (Zhang, 2008). Instead, PCPs working in rural township health centers are the most easily accessible and affordable doctors to the patients in rural areas, especially for the elderly and those with lower socioeconomic status. Therefore, PCPs should play a crucial role in managing rural residents’ mental health issues. However, challenges in delivering mental health care were reported by rural PCPs that some lacked professional knowledge in psychiatry and some others claimed that the insufficient subsidies made mental health care service delivery difficult (Ma et al., 2015). Additionally, some were reluctant to provide mental health care as they held negative perceptions toward mental disorders, such as feared of being attacked by patients with schizophrenia; some were also worried about discrimination against those who served the mental health patients (Ma et al., 2015). Hence, rural residents often fail to receive timely and good quality mental health care services. Furthermore, formal diagnosis of mental health problems including depression and anxiety disorders often need to be made by psychiatrists. It is uncertain about PCPs’ involvement in managing and referring patients with mental health problems (Sun et al., 2018).
Despite the influencing factors summarized, there was limited information about PCPs’ contribution to mental health care in rural China. This study aims to quantify mental health care provision by PCPs in rural China and explore the association with their training background.
Methods
Sampling and data collection
This study was part of a larger research project investigating primary care services in rural China. Details of the study design and findings on the factors for enhancing patients’ trust were published elsewhere (Cai et al., 2021). Ethical approvals were obtained from the Institutional Review Board of the University of Hong Kong/Hospital Authority Hong Kong West Cluster (UW19-346) and Zhejiang University (ZGL201904-2). We conducted a cross-sectional survey in rural areas of Zhejiang Province, China, from December 2019 to January 2020. There were around 21,100 PCPs in community-based health facilities in Zhejiang. PCPs were recruited using a stratified cluster sampling method. We randomly selected two counties (Ning Hai and Wu Yi) in the developed areas, and two counties (Pan An and Jiang Shan) in the less developed areas. All township health centers and affiliated units located within the four selected counties were included in this study. The target population of this study was PCPs who were working in a township-based health center or unit and holding a qualification for clinical practices certified by health authorities.
We collaborated with local health bureaus and a list of local township health facility directors and contact details were provided. We emphasized voluntary participation to directors and refusal to participate would not affect interests of their facilities. After obtaining approval from facility directors, we invited eligible PCPs working on survey days. We explained the research purpose and survey content, and ensured potential participants’ anonymity for the study. The PCPs were invited with informed consent to answer a questionnaire using an online questionnaire tool ‘Sojump’.
Questionnaire
The questionnaire was developed based on formative qualitative data, our previous primary care study conducted in Zhejiang province (Wu, 2017) and our mental health study on PCPs in Hong Kong (Lam et al., 2018). The survey questionnaire collected information about (1) socio-demographic information of the rural PCPs including age, sex, education, annual income, general practitioner qualification, years of practice; (2) mental health training background and self-reported confidence in diagnosing and managing mental health problems; (3) patients’ consultation pattern for mental health related issues; (4) the PCPs’ clinical practice in mental health care, including asking questions relating to mental wellbeing, managing patients’ mental health problems, and making referrals to psychiatrists; and (5) whether the PCPs made formal diagnoses of anxiety and depression in their working institutions.
Data analysis
The survey data were analyzed using SPSS Version 25 (IBM Corporation, NY, USA). Descriptive analysis was conducted to summarize the demographic characteristics of rural PCPs, and their clinical practice in managing mental health problems. Pearson Chi-squared test was used to test for the association of PCPs’ clinical practice with their background including gender, education level, and mental health training, whereas two-sample t-test and one-way ANOVA were conducted for the continuous variable years of practice. A p-value <.05 was considered statistically significant.
Results
Demographic and clinical backgrounds of respondents
Among 849 invited, 697 PCPs participated in this study. Excluding duplicated responses, the number of valid questionnaires was 673, resulting in a valid response rate of 79.3%. There were slightly more PCPs working in developed rural areas (57.9%), and slightly more female physicians responded (54.8%). Nearly two-fifths of the respondents reported less than 10 years of experience. The majority of PCPs had obtained formal general practitioner qualification (70.6%), and university level of education or above (71.2%). Details of their demographic characteristics were reported elsewhere (Cai et al., 2021).
Training background and confidence in mental health care
Over two-thirds of the respondents (68.2%) had never received any training on treating common mental health disorders while 20.3% received at most 2 days of training; 6.4% received 3 to 20 days of training; and 5.1% received more than 20 days of training (Table 1). Respondents had varied responses to their confidence in diagnosing patients with mental health problems. Less than 10% of respondents felt ‘very confident’ in diagnosing patients, 45.2% were ‘rather confident’ in diagnosing patients and 42.3% were ‘not very confident’. Only 2.7% felt they were ‘not confident at all’. A similar pattern was observed when it comes to respondents’ confidence in managing these patients. Around 10% were ‘very confident’ in managing patients, 42.9% were ‘rather confident’, 43.5% were ‘not very confident’, and 3.0% felt that they were ‘not confident at all’.

Practice in managing patients with mental health problems
A significant number of respondents reported that their patients would mention to them about their mental health problems (Table 2). Nearly one-fourth (23.9%) of respondents reported that their patients ‘always’ mentioned their mental health issues and 49.6% ‘sometimes’ did so. Less than 20% of respondents reported their patients ‘rarely’ raised the issue and only 7.1% ‘never’ mentioned it. It was not uncommon for respondents to encounter patients with a mental-health-related chief complaint/symptom. Forty-five percent of respondents had 1 to 5 patients who came to them for mental-health-related issues on average each week; 11.9% encountered 6 to 10 patients; 7.6% had 11 to 20 patients; and 5% had over 20 patients per week. The remaining 30.3% reported no such patients seen.

Although many respondents reported that they ‘always’ (42.2%) or ‘sometimes’ (42.2%) provided follow-up for patients with mental health problems, a large majority had not referred these patients to psychiatrists. Almost 40% had never referred patients and 49.8% referred 1% to 20% of their patients. Only 6.4% referred 21% to 60% of patients with mental health issues and 4.8% referred 60% to 100% of these patients to psychiatrists. Most participants reported that according to their workplace instructions, they were not allowed to make a diagnosis of common mental health disorders during patients’ first visit. Only 8.5% and 7.0% reported that they could make a diagnosis of anxiety and depression respectively.
Association between PCPs’ background characteristics and their management of mental health problems
We explored the association of PCP’s personal and training background with their management of mental health problems (Table 3). Respondents who had received some sort of training on treating common mental health disorders were more likely to have a higher level of confidence in diagnosing (p < .001) and managing patients (p < .001).

In terms of identifying patients with potential mental health problems, respondents who had received training (p < .001) and with longer years of practice (p < .001) were also more likely to have patients who brought up their mental health issues. Respondents received training (p < .001), being male (p < .001), with longer years of practice (p < .001), and having higher level of education (p = .003) tended to perceive seeing a higher number of patients who came with a mental-health related chief complaint/symptom.
In terms of management of mental health disorders, respondents who received mental health training were more likely to provide follow-up for patients (p = .002) who brought up mental health issues during consultation, as well as referring potential cases to psychiatrists (p < .001). Male respondents (p < .001) and those with longer years of practice (p < .001) were also more likely to make referrals to psychiatrists.
Association between training length in mental health and management of mental health problems
We further analyzed the association of PCP’s training length in mental health and their management of mental health problems (Table 4). Significant differences in response patterns were shown for all indicators (ranging from p = .028 to p < .001). Specific trends can be observed for some items. Compared with no training, higher proportion of respondents who had received a half day of training or less were confident of diagnosing (49.7% vs. 62.1%) and managing patients with mental health problems (48.4% vs. 59.1%). The proportions reached 76.7% and 69.8% for diagnosis and management, respectively for respondents with 3 to 20 days of training, and no/minimal rise for those with over 20 days of training. Similarly, perceived number of patients who came with a mental-health related chief complaint/symptom was highest among those respondents with 3 to 20 days or over 20 days of training. Respondents with 3 to 20 days training had the highest percentage of patients with mental health problems referred to psychiatrists, and the percentage dropped for the group with over 20 days of training.

Discussion
Despite there were large scale studies on the prevalence of common mental health problems in China (Huang et al., 2019; Zhou et al., 2014), findings about PCPs’ involvement in mental health care were limited and tended to suggest negative outcomes (Gupta et al., 2016). Our study addressed a knowledge gap to quantify the clinical practice of the rural PCPs and explored the association with their personal and training background. Overall, the rural PCPs reported a median range of seeing 1 to 5 mental health patients per week. Estimated from the median range, the numbers of mental health-related consultations encountered by each rural PCP were approximately 150 per year, which means over 30 million such consultations by the 21,100 PCPs in Zhejiang province of China. There is a substantial scope for improvement in practice considering the large number of PCPs and patients.
We found that the PCPs’ practice in mental health care was mainly determined by whether they had received mental health training, followed by years of practice. Nearly one third of the PCPs had some sort of training and this group significantly performed better in mental health care in terms of confidence and practice characteristics, while years of practice made a difference in practice but not confidence. Interestingly, PCPs with training for 3 days or above perceived highest number of patients coming with a mental-health related chief complaint/symptom. They might be more likely to be able to ‘identify’ patients with mental health problems. For example, a patient with anxiety disorder who presents with dizziness (which can also be a symptom of biological complaint) would be more likely to have his/her mental health problem identified by a PCP with more training. A PCP with less training may treat it as a ‘dizziness’ due to a biological complaint for example problem of the ear’s vestibular system. To enhance recognition of common mental health problems which often present as somatic complaints, mental health training should be promoted widely to most PCPs in China. Considering feasibility, training can focus on recognition and initial management of mental health problems. Our study suggests the training length to be 3 to 20 days (over 16 sessions) as minimal additional effect was reported for those with over 20 days of training. Similar short training with significant outcomes were reported in Hong Kong (Lam et al., 2016).
Only 8.5% and 7.0% of the PCPs reported that they were allowed to make a diagnosis of anxiety and depression respectively in their working institutions. Previous studies reported that apart from having insufficient knowledge on mental health care (Ma et al., 2015), PCPs also faced challenges in prescribing medication for patients with mental disorders (Searle et al., 2019). Due to resources and safety concerns, Chinese essential drug list for primary care did not cover psychiatric drugs. The PCPs were not generally qualified to prescribe antidepressants (Searle et al., 2019). Patterns of psychotropic drug use can be affected by local regulations, facility types (Terada et al., 2019), and traditions of psychiatric practice (Xiang et al., 2007). Our study found that PCPs who had mental health training were more likely to follow-up patients with mental health issues and refer them to psychiatrists. This indicates that despite the limited legitimacy of PCPs to make formal diagnosis for mental health patients, they can still have significant contribution in recognizing these patients and make proper referrals. This is indeed the holistic approach emphasized by the concept of ‘family doctor’. However, it needs further exploration to investigate whether the PCPs would continue to follow-up their patients’ mental health problems after making referrals.
There is also a need to extend national basic public health services package to cover PCPs’ mental health services for depression and anxiety disorders. Currently, the package includes management of psychiatric patients by PCPs but limited to those with a severe mental disorder. PCPs are asked to follow-up these patients (e.g. update health information and conduct medical examinations) after diagnosis by psychiatrists. We suggest extending the coverage to patients with common mental health problems. Furthermore, policy makers may consider increasing the unit payment of the public health services package by the government to rural township health centers as an incentive for enhancing mental health service coverage.
This study had several limitations. First, only rural PCPs in an economically better off eastern province were included in this study. The results may not be generalizable to other geographical areas of rural China. Second, we adopted self-reported measures in this study, and when it comes to clinical practice characteristics, PCPs may prefer to report more positive feedback which would cause reports bias. To triangulate the findings, future studies can evaluate rural patients’ views and experiences in mental health care by PCPs. Third, our study was conducted before the COVID-19 pandemic. There may be increase in mental health care demand during and after the pandemic (Xu et al., 2021).
Conclusions
Our findings indicate that there is a high demand for mental health care services by PCPs in rural China. Training in mental health is the key determinant of their practice. Some training, even for a half-day, could significantly improve their mental health care capacity. Balancing the time cost and effect of training, we suggest the training length to be 3 to 20 days, which can inform national policy to target the two-thirds of the PCPs who received no training in mental health. Along with training, there is a need to overcome structural barriers including legitimacy of PCPs to make a diagnosis of depression/anxiety and extending the national basic public health services package to cover common mental health problems.
